Ankündigung

Einklappen
Keine Ankündigung bisher.

Problem bei Radiobutton abfragen

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• Problem bei Radiobutton abfragen

    Hallo alle zusammen.

    Ich versuche gerade PHP zu lernen.
    Ich habe ein Beispiel aus einem Buch abgetippt und obwohl ich alles genauso wie im Buch gemachte habe bekomme ich immer nur die Meldung "Abfrage konnte nicht durchgeführt werden.

    PHP-Code:
    <?php
    // connect to mysql
    mysql_connect("localhost""username""password") OR die ("Keine Verbindung möglich!");
    // select which database you want to search
    mysql_select_db("database") or die ("Datenbank nicht gefunden!");

    $abfrage "SELECT * FROM haendler_db WHERE Land LIKE ";

    switch (
    $_post["auswahl"])
    {
        case 
    Deutschland:
            
    $abfrage .= "Deutschland";
            break;
        case 
    England:
            
    $abfrage .= "England";
            break;
        case 
    USA:
            
    $abfrage .= "USA";
    }
    $ergebnis mysql_query ($abfrage) or die ("Abfrage konnte nicht durchgeführt werden");
    echo 
    "<p class='rahmen'>Comichändler</p>";
    while (
    $r mysql_fetch_array($ergebnis))
    {
        
    $haendler $r["Haendler"];
        
    $land $r["Land"];
        
    $url $r["URL"];
        
    $link "<a href=\"$url\">$haendler</a>";

        echo 
    "<p class='rahmen_2'>$link</p>";
    }
    ?>
    Kann mir bitte jemand helfen und sagen was ich falsch mache.

    Herzlichen Dank
    Elroy7000

  • #2
    AW: Problem bei Radiobutton abfragen

    Hallo, Elroy7000

    Du musst Hostname durch den Hosname des Serves nemen den Username und auch dein passwort übergeben.

    PHP-Code:
    mysql_connect("localhost""username""password") OR die ("Keine Verbindung möglich!"); 

    z.B.
    PHP-Code:
    mysql_connect("Hostname""test""test-passwort") OR die ("Keine Verbindung möglich!"); 
    Aber wenn du Xampp benutzt kannst du statt dein Hostname angeben localhost nemen.
    Triopsi Hosting
    ---------
    Wir helfen gerne! | Domains, SSL, TS, Webspace Hoster seit 2008.

    Kommentar


    • #3
      AW: Problem bei Radiobutton abfragen

      Das ist schon klar triopsi.

      localhost ist der hostname meines Servers. Username und Passwort habe ich hier geändert. Ist glaube ich nicht so gut wenn ich hier meinen Username und Passwort poste.

      Also die Verbindung wird hergestellt.
      Eine einfache Abfrage klappt auch, nur mit den Radiobuttons will es nicht klappen.

      Gruss
      Elroy

      Kommentar


      • #4
        AW: Problem bei Radiobutton abfragen

        Hallo,

        wäre gut auch den Formularteil mit den Radiobuttons zu posten, damit man Fehler suchen kann.

        daniel5959
        WindSolarMobil.de - neu ab 2023
        FindeLinks.de - seit Ende 2022 als Archiv
        Homepage-FAQs.de - seit Ende 2020 offline

        Kommentar


        • #5
          AW: Problem bei Radiobutton abfragen

          Hier ist der HTML Teil inklisive der Head Einträge.

          HTML-Code:
          <html xmlns="http://www.w3.org/1999/xhtml">
          <head>
          <meta http-equiv="content-type" content="text/html; charset=iso-8859-1">
          <title>Händler Seite</title>
          <link rel="stylesheet" type="text/css" href="inc/menu.css">
            <style type="text/css">
            body {
              font: normal 100.01% Helvetica, Arial, sans-serif;
              color: black; background-color:rgb(227,227,227);
            }
            .rahmen {
             text-align: center; border-width: medium;
             border-style: solid;
            }
            .rahmen_2 {
             text-align: center; border-width: medium;
             border-style: groove;
            }
          
            </style>
          </head>
          <body>
          <div align="center">
          <p><img src="image/logo.jpg" alt="Logo"></p>
          </div>
          <div id="navcontainer">
          <ul id="navlist">
          <li id="active"><a href="index.html" id="current">Home</a></li>
          <li><a href="form.html">Comic Sammlung</a></li>
          <li><a href="http://www.comicfriend.de/phpdvdprofiler/">DVD Sammlung</a></li>
          <li><a href="haendler.php">Händler</a></li>
          <li><a href="links.html">Links</a></li>
          </ul>
          </div>
          <br />
          <div align="center">
          <p>Im Internet kaufe ich Comics von den verschiedesten Händlern.
          Hier befindet sich eine Linkliste mit den Adressen einiger dieser Händler</p>
          <p>Hier können sie wählen von welchem Land die Händler sein sollen.</p>
          <form action = "haendler.php" method = "post">
          <input type="radio" name="auswahl" value="Deutschland">Deutschland
          <input type="radio" name="auswahl" value="England">England
          <input type="radio" name="auswahl" value="USA">USA
          <p></p>
          <input type="submit" value=" Anzeigen ">
          </form>
          </div>
          <br />
          Es handelt sich noch nicht um den entgültigen code.
          Wie gesagt ich lerne noch.

          Elroy

          Kommentar


          • #6
            AW: Problem bei Radiobutton abfragen

            Probiers doch mal so:

            PHP-Code:
            <?php
            // connect to mysql
            mysql_connect("localhost""username""password") OR die ("Keine Verbindung möglich!");
            // select which database you want to search
            mysql_select_db("database") or die ("Datenbank nicht gefunden!");

            $abfrage "SELECT * FROM haendler_db WHERE Land LIKE '" $_POST["auswahl"] . "'";
            $ergebnis mysql_query ($abfrage) or die ("Abfrage konnte nicht durchgeführt werden");
            echo 
            "<p class='rahmen'>Comichändler</p>";
            while (
            $r mysql_fetch_array($ergebnis))
            {
                
            $haendler $r["Haendler"];
                
            $land $r["Land"];
                
            $url $r["URL"];
                
            $link "<a href=\"$url\">$haendler</a>";

                echo 
            "<p class='rahmen_2'>$link</p>";
            }
            ?>

            Kommentar


            • #7
              AW: Problem bei Radiobutton abfragen

              Zitat von LuWa Beitrag anzeigen
              Probiers doch mal so:

              PHP-Code:
              <?php
              // connect to mysql
              mysql_connect("localhost""username""password") OR die ("Keine Verbindung möglich!");
              // select which database you want to search
              mysql_select_db("database") or die ("Datenbank nicht gefunden!");

              $abfrage "SELECT * FROM haendler_db WHERE Land LIKE '" $_POST["auswahl"] . "'";
              $ergebnis mysql_query ($abfrage) or die ("Abfrage konnte nicht durchgeführt werden");
              echo 
              "<p class='rahmen'>Comichändler</p>";
              while (
              $r mysql_fetch_array($ergebnis))
              {
                  
              $haendler $r["Haendler"];
                  
              $land $r["Land"];
                  
              $url $r["URL"];
                  
              $link "<a href=\"$url\">$haendler</a>";

                  echo 
              "<p class='rahmen_2'>$link</p>";
              }
              ?>
              Danke für deine Hilfe LuWa.
              So funktionierts.

              Gruss
              Elroy

              Kommentar

              homepage-forum.de - Hilfe für Webmaster! Statistiken

              Einklappen

              Themen: 57.255   Beiträge: 432.197   Mitglieder: 29.677   Aktive Mitglieder: 21
              Willkommen an unser neuestes Mitglied, Euro_crem.

              Online-Benutzer

              Einklappen

              496 Benutzer sind jetzt online. Registrierte Benutzer: 0, Gäste: 496.

              Mit 9.939 Benutzern waren am 17.05.2023 um 21:38 die meisten Benutzer gleichzeitig online.

              Die neuesten Themen

              Einklappen

              Die neuesten Beiträge

              Einklappen

              Lädt...
              X
              😀
              🥰
              🤢
              😎
              😡
              👍
              👎